The second Barringer/RFC special with the #25 ran the entire length of the RGS. Dick Jackson's son Jim took the color slides that drgwk37 posted. He also shot 8mm movies of this train. It seems the Jacksons chased the train to Dolores or Rico then boarded the train as Jim shot movies from the train of #25 working its way north. It seem that pre-1939 Kodachrome (both 355mm slide film and 8mm movie film had problems with color stability as all the color Jackson slides and films of 1938 have the color almost completely washed out. Everything from 1939 on has good color.

Al Chione sold the copy slides and films back in the 1970's
